  • Ensuring Tenants Protection: A Guide For Renters

    Being a renter comes with its own set of challenges and uncertainties. From dealing with landlords to navigating lease agreements, tenants often find themselves in vulnerable positions. However, there are laws and regulations in place to protect tenants and ensure they have a safe and comfortable living environment. In this article, we will explore the importance of tenants protection and provide tips on how renters can advocate for their rights.

    One of the most fundamental aspects of tenants protection is the lease agreement. This legally binding document outlines the terms and conditions of the rental arrangement, including rent amount, lease duration, and tenant responsibilities. It is crucial for renters to thoroughly review the lease before signing it to ensure that their rights are protected. Tenants should pay close attention to clauses regarding maintenance responsibilities, security deposits, and eviction procedures.

    In addition to the lease agreement, renters are also protected by state and federal laws. These laws establish guidelines for landlords and outline the rights and responsibilities of tenants. For example, most states have laws that require landlords to provide safe and habitable living conditions for tenants. This includes ensuring that the property is free from health hazards, that essential utilities are in working order, and that necessary repairs are made in a timely manner.

    Furthermore, tenants have the right to privacy in their rental unit. Landlords are not allowed to enter a tenant’s home without proper notice except in cases of emergency. This protection helps ensure that renters can enjoy a sense of security and peace of mind in their living space.

    Another crucial aspect of tenants protection is the security deposit. Landlords often require tenants to pay a security deposit before moving in to cover any damages or unpaid rent. State laws typically regulate how security deposits are handled, including the requirements for documenting damages and refunding the deposit when the lease ends. Renters should keep detailed records of the move-in condition of the property to protect themselves in case of any disputes over the security deposit.

    In the unfortunate event of an eviction, tenants also have rights that protect them from wrongful or illegal eviction. Landlords must follow specific procedures and provide proper notice before evicting a tenant. Renters have the opportunity to respond to eviction notices and challenge them in court if necessary. It is important for tenants to understand their rights in these situations and seek legal assistance if needed.

    While tenants protection laws provide significant safeguards for renters, it is essential for tenants to advocate for themselves and take proactive steps to protect their rights. One way renters can ensure their protection is by maintaining open and honest communication with their landlords. Renters should promptly report any maintenance issues or concerns to their landlord and document all communication in writing.

    Additionally, renters can educate themselves about their rights as tenants by researching relevant laws and regulations in their state. Many resources are available online, including state-specific tenant rights organizations and legal aid services. By arming themselves with knowledge, tenants can confidently assert their rights and hold landlords accountable for providing safe and habitable living conditions.

  • Advancements In Lateral Flow Immunoassay Development

    Lateral flow immunoassays (LFIA) have become increasingly popular due to their simplicity, rapid results, and cost-effectiveness. These tests are commonly used in various fields such as healthcare, agriculture, food safety, and environmental monitoring. The development of lateral flow immunoassays has seen significant advancements in recent years, leading to improved sensitivity, specificity, and multiplexing capabilities.

    The basic principle of a lateral flow immunoassay involves the detection of a target analyte in a sample through the binding of specific antibodies. The sample is applied to a sample pad, where it flows through the test strip via capillary action. As the sample flows along the strip, it encounters various zones containing antibodies that are specific to the target analyte. If the target analyte is present in the sample, it will bind to the antibodies and produce a visible signal, typically a colored line.

    One of the key advancements in lateral flow immunoassay development is the enhancement of assay sensitivity. Early lateral flow tests were limited in their ability to detect low concentrations of analytes, especially in complex sample matrices. However, through the use of improved antibody technologies, signal amplification methods, and innovative detection strategies, researchers have been able to achieve higher sensitivity levels. This has led to the development of lateral flow immunoassays that can detect analytes at picogram or even femtogram levels, making them suitable for a wide range of applications, including early disease diagnosis and environmental monitoring.

    Another area of advancement in lateral flow immunoassay development is the improvement of assay specificity. Cross-reactivity with non-target molecules has been a significant challenge in the past, leading to false positive results. To overcome this issue, researchers have developed novel antibody engineering techniques, such as the use of monoclonal antibodies and recombinant antibody fragments, which exhibit high specificity towards the target analyte. In addition, the incorporation of blocking agents and competitive assays has helped reduce non-specific binding, further enhancing assay specificity.

    Multiplexing capability is another important advancement in lateral flow immunoassay development. Traditional lateral flow tests are limited to detecting a single analyte at a time. However, the ability to simultaneously detect multiple analytes in a single test has become increasingly important in many applications. Researchers have developed multiplex lateral flow immunoassays by incorporating multiple test lines on the same strip, each specific to a different analyte. This has enabled the simultaneous detection of multiple targets in a single sample, providing a comprehensive analysis in a time-efficient manner.

    In addition to advancements in sensitivity, specificity, and multiplexing capability, researchers have also focused on improving the user-friendliness of lateral flow immunoassays. This includes the development of digital lateral flow devices that provide objective, quantitative results, eliminating the subjectivity associated with visual interpretation of test results. Furthermore, the integration of smartphone apps for result analysis and data storage has made lateral flow immunoassays more accessible and convenient for end-users.

    The future of lateral flow immunoassay development holds great promise, with ongoing research focusing on further improving assay performance and expanding applications. One area of interest is the development of multiplex lateral flow immunoassays for point-of-care diagnostics, allowing healthcare providers to rapidly screen for multiple diseases in a single test. Another area of research is the incorporation of novel detection technologies, such as nanoparticles and microfluidics, to enhance the sensitivity and speed of lateral flow tests.

  • The Importance Of Biosecurity In Pigs

    biosecurity in pigs is a crucial aspect of maintaining the health and well-being of these animals. With the rise of various diseases and pathogens that can negatively impact pig populations, implementing proper biosecurity measures is essential to prevent outbreaks and protect both the animals and the industry as a whole.

    Biosecurity refers to the procedures and practices put in place to minimize the risk of introducing and spreading diseases within a population. In the case of pigs, biosecurity measures are particularly important due to the high susceptibility of pigs to various diseases, as well as their ability to easily transmit diseases to other pigs.

    One of the primary reasons why biosecurity in pigs is so important is the potential for disease outbreaks to have devastating consequences on pig populations. Diseases such as African swine fever, foot-and-mouth disease, and porcine reproductive and respiratory syndrome can spread rapidly among pigs, leading to high mortality rates and significant economic losses for pig farmers. By implementing strict biosecurity protocols, pig farmers can reduce the risk of disease introduction and transmission, safeguarding their livestock and livelihoods.

    biosecurity in pigs is also essential for preventing the spread of zoonotic diseases, which are diseases that can be transmitted from animals to humans. Pigs can act as a reservoir for various zoonotic pathogens, such as salmonella and influenza, which can pose a serious health risk to humans. By maintaining good biosecurity practices, pig farmers can minimize the risk of zoonotic disease transmission and protect both themselves and the general public.

    There are several key components of biosecurity in pigs that farmers must adhere to in order to effectively minimize the risk of disease transmission. These include controlling access to pig facilities, proper sanitation and hygiene practices, and monitoring and managing pig movements. Controlling access to pig facilities involves restricting entry to only essential personnel and implementing measures such as foot baths and protective clothing to prevent the introduction of pathogens from outside sources.

    Sanitation and hygiene practices are also crucial aspects of biosecurity in pigs. This includes regularly cleaning and disinfecting pig facilities, equipment, and vehicles to eliminate any potential sources of contamination. Proper waste management is also important to prevent the buildup of pathogens and reduce the risk of disease transmission within the pig population.

    Monitoring and managing pig movements is another key aspect of biosecurity in pigs. This involves keeping detailed records of pig movements on and off the farm, as well as implementing quarantine procedures for newly arriving pigs to prevent the introduction of diseases. By closely monitoring pig movements and implementing strict biosecurity protocols, pig farmers can reduce the risk of disease transmission within their herds.

    In addition to these basic biosecurity measures, pig farmers can also implement additional strategies to further enhance biosecurity on their farms. This may include installing perimeter fencing to prevent unauthorized access, conducting regular health screenings and vaccinations for pigs, and establishing biosecurity protocols for visitors and deliveries to the farm.

  • The Importance Of A Ball Valve PTFE Seat In Industrial Applications

    In the world of industrial applications, ensuring the proper functioning of valves is crucial for the efficient operation of machinery and systems One key component of a ball valve that plays a significant role in its performance is the PTFE seat The PTFE seat acts as a seal between the ball and the valve body, preventing leakage and ensuring smooth operation In this article, we will delve into the importance of a ball valve PTFE seat and its various benefits in industrial applications.

    1 Superior Sealing Properties
    One of the primary functions of a ball valve PTFE seat is to provide a tight seal between the ball and the valve body PTFE, also known as polytetrafluoroethylene, is a highly durable and chemically resistant material that offers excellent sealing properties It is capable of withstanding high pressure and temperatures, making it ideal for industrial applications where reliability is paramount The PTFE seat ensures that the valve remains leak-free, preventing costly downtimes and damage to equipment.

    2 Corrosion Resistance
    In industrial environments where the presence of corrosive chemicals or gases is common, the ball valve PTFE seat offers superior corrosion resistance PTFE is inert and does not react with most chemicals, making it an ideal material for applications where exposure to harsh substances is likely The PTFE seat ensures that the valve remains unaffected by corrosive agents, prolonging its lifespan and reducing maintenance costs.

    3 Smooth Operation
    The PTFE seat in a ball valve provides a low-friction surface between the ball and the valve body, ensuring smooth operation The self-lubricating properties of PTFE reduce wear and tear on the valve components, resulting in a longer service life and improved performance ball valve ptfe seat. The smooth operation of the ball valve is essential for precise control of flow rates and the efficient functioning of industrial processes.

    4 High Temperature Resistance
    In applications where high temperatures are a concern, the ball valve PTFE seat excels in providing reliable performance PTFE can withstand temperatures up to 260°C (500°F) without losing its sealing properties or mechanical strength This high temperature resistance makes PTFE an excellent choice for applications such as steam service, chemical processing, and power generation, where exposure to extreme heat is common.
